EVENING CHURCH SERVICES
National Broadcast Series
Four evening church services are being presented on a national network under the auspices of the central religious advisory committee of the New Zealand Broadcasting Service, according to a recent issue of “Zealandia,” the Catholic newspaper.
The services are being presented at three-monthly intervals. Choirs that have reached a high musical standard are being used in the services. The first of the series was presented in January by a Methodist Church and the second was last Sunday by a Catholic church.
